Attack on Titan (Shingeki no Kyojin) Status: Anime Complete | Manga Complete The Hook: Humanity lives within three massive stone walls to protect themselves from man-eating Titans. When the outer wall is breached, young Eren Yeager vows to exterminate them all.

Part 3: Soulful Stories – Drama, Slice of Life, and Romance Not all anime involves fighting. Some of the most impactful series are quiet, introspective stories about the human condition. 1. Frieren: Beyond Journey's End (Sousou no Frieren) Status: Anime Ongoing | Manga Ongoing The Hook: The Demon King has been defeated, and the hero’s party is disbanded. The story follows Frieren, an elven mage who lives for thousands of years, as she retraces her journey to understand the human heart and mourn her fallen comrade.
